Full Job Description
We’re looking for a Senior Designer to join our Creative team — a versatile creative who brings strong conceptual thinking, refined design craft, and the ability to execute beautifully across a range of mediums. From marketing campaigns to advertising, collateral, experiential design, and digital assets, this role will shape high‑impact creative work seen across our business. About the Role: The Senior Designer is a core contributor within the Creative organization, responsible for developing visually compelling designs that align with brand standards and support strategic marketing and communication goals. You’ll collaborate with marketing strategists and creative leads across the enterprise to produce high‑quality creative assets. This role requires deep experience in layout, typography, systems thinking, integrated campaign development, and channel specific applications. You’ll work on a broad mix of deliverables — from campaign concepts and digital advertising to digital destinations, brochures, sales collateral, event materials, and environmental/experiential designs. The ideal candidate is a well‑rounded designer who’s comfortable owning complex assignments, refining creative details, and contributing to the evolution of the brand. What You’ll Do: Design Across Multiple Mediums • Produce high‑quality digital and print designs including web assets, display ads, social creative, brochures, flyers, one‑pagers, and signage. • Create materials for marketing campaigns, product launches, and advertising initiatives. • Support environmental and experiential design needs such as event graphics, trade show materials, and large‑format layouts. Bring Concepts & Storytelling to Life • Translate creative briefs and concept direction into compelling visual solutions. • Partner with Marketing strategists and creative leads to express ideas clearly and cohesively across deliverables. • Develop visual narratives, frameworks, and presentation materials that enhance storytelling. Support Brand Consistency & Quality • Apply the enterprise visual identity system across all mediums with precision and consistency. • Contribute ideas to refine and enhance templates, design systems, and best practices. • Participate in design reviews and incorporate feedback to improve work. Collaborate Across Creative & Marketing Teams • Work closely with the Creative Leads, marketing partners, and cross‑functional stakeholders. • Communicate design decisions clearly and present work with rationale. • Balance multiple assignments, deadlines, and priorities in a fast‑paced environment. Deliver on Craft, Detail & Production • Prepare final files for print and digital production with accuracy. • Ensure deliverables meet technical specifications and accessibility standards. • Collaborate with vendors, print partners or production teams as needed. Key Mindsets • Collaborative and adaptable: able to navigate team dynamics, timelines, and client contexts while delivering exceptional design with low ego. • Story‑First Problem Solving: They don’t just decorate — they clarify. Your instinct is to always ask: “What’s the problem we’re solving, and how do we visually communicate it with simplicity and impact?” • Growth oriented and resilient: open to feedback, eager to iterate, and comfortable learning through experimentation and critique. • Curious and proactive: able to generate ideas, take initiative, and contribute wherever needed, from early exploration to final delivery. They seek context, ask smart questions, and surface ideas or risks early. They are the kind of designer who takes initiative and pushes the work to be better, not just “done.” What You Bring • Bachelor of Fine Arts (BFA) in Graphic Design, Bachelor of Design or equivalent • 5-7+ years of professional design experience (agency or in‑house) •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Cloud, Figma, and presentation design tools and libraries • Experience in using MS Office (Word, Power Point) • Ability to work independently, manage complex projects, and deliver high‑quality work under deadlines • Strong portfolio demonstrating crosschannel design work across integrated campaigns, digital destinations, and print Salary Range: $83,100 - 141,300 USD Salary range is a good faith estimate of base pay. Northern Trust provides a comprehensive benefits package including retirement benefits (401k and pension), health and welfare benefits (medical, dental, vision, spending accounts and disability), paid time off, parental and caregiver leave, life & accident insurance, and other voluntary and well-being benefits. Northern Trust also provides a discretionary bonus program that may include an equity component.
